A truck accident could be more complicated than car crashes due to the possibility of multiple parties being liable. Based on the circumstances, the driver as well as the company for which they work, as well as the freight broker could all be held liable for the incident. They all have their own duties, responsibilities, and must adhere to different rules.
A trucker's accident history may raise questions about their driving skills. This is why it is crucial for victims to contact a truck accident attorney as soon as they can so they can file a lawsuit when the negligence of the trucker resulted in an accident.
An experienced lawyer for trucking can pinpoint the reason for the accident and determine those who were negligent and need to be held accountable for your loss. They can examine the scene of the accident and gather crucial evidence, such as police reports, witness testimony and accident photos. aurora semi truck accident attorney will also hire experts to analyze the truck's engine electronic control module (ECM) as well as brake system, tire damage and other factors that are relevant to the accident.

Truck accidents are more complicated and involve multiple parties more than other vehicle accidents. Truck drivers, trucking companies and cargo haulers, and possibly other contractors and employees may all be involved. Each of these parties has their own set of responsibilities that must be met to ensure the safety of all road users. Determining fault can be difficult due to this. A truck accident lawyer will know how to gather all the data and use it to create an argument that is strong on your behalf.
Commercial trucks are larger and heavier than other vehicles, which means the injuries that result from accidents involving them are more severe. Victims of these types of accidents can face extensive medical bills and need special treatment that is expensive. Furthermore, these injuries tend to be more severe than those sustained in car accidents. Due to this, trucking companies and drivers need to have more hefty liability insurance policies to cover the damage they cause.
In addition to medical expenses those who suffer from accidents may also require financial assistance to compensate for lost wages and a diminished earning capacity. It is crucial to find an experienced truck accident lawyer with experience in recovering monetary compensation on behalf of their clients. They can determine what economic damages you are entitled to and help you seek them.
A skilled lawyer for truck accidents is aware of the responsibilities of the different parties involved in a truck crash. They will know how to collect the relevant information, including medical reports, police reports, photos of the crash scene and witness statements from all parties. The evidence can be used to prove a person's negligence, and that the crash and injuries were caused by the negligence of another party.
It is crucial that truck accident lawyers are acquainted with the laws and regulations that govern this particular industry. This is because the trucking industry is heavily controlled by both state and federal agencies. This includes requiring truckers, employers and vehicle inspectors to maintain complete logbook and inspection records. A truck accident attorney will know how to obtain this information and use it to prove that the party was negligent in the incident.

It is essential to locate a law office that has the resources necessary to thoroughly investigate your case. For example, they should be able to access data from the black box, that records information about driving habits and helps determine the cause of your accident. They should be able employ experts to testify in court on topics such as safety of trucking, FMCSA rules, and the physics that cause truck accidents.
